Step Brothers Review

After their parents get married two unemployed middle aged men (Will Ferrell, John C. Reilly) who still live at home are forced to live in the same house.

Who is the Audience for This Movie?

People who like quirky comedies.

What I Liked About This Movie

Step Brothers takes only 7 minutes to set up the premise. Throwing you into jokes as fast as they possibly could was a great move. Ferrell and Reilly were previously paired together in the hilarious Talladega Nights and once again they have really good comedic chemistry together. I do not know if this is a compliment or not but the two comedians play very believable man children too well.

Step Brothers Photo

You are most likely wanting to know if it is funny or not. I can happily say that Step Brothers is consistently funny and brings the comedy even while the credits are rolling. One scene in particular involves t-bagging and a drum set. It is best if I leave the connection between the two to your imagination.

What Didn’t Work For Me

Step Brothers felt a bit long winded. I think they should have cut the run time down marginally and cut out some of the weaker jokes to streamline the movie more. As you would expect there is a moment in the movie the two men realize that they need to grow up and the realization section of the plot was handled a little clumsily.

Should You Watch This Movie?

If you are looking for a solid comedy you cannot go wrong with Step Brothers.
